The military inspired Delta-Recon Quadcopter with HD Camera in tactical green from Kolibri, includes an FPV 720p resolution camera enabling you to stream and record your aerial missions in HD quality, directly to your smart device. It features a quad-rotor design with integrated prop guards. To pilot the Delta-Recon, a 4-channel, 2.4GHz handheld transmitter comes in the box and is pre-bound to the aircraft, or simply download the UDI RC app to your smart device and take control.

Auto Launch & Landing Single button press will safely land or launch and hover the Discover Delta-Recon.

Custom Route ModeAllows you to trace your desired flight path on the mobile device screen and the drone will follow along the path unassisted.

720p HD Camera with FPV The camera records to a microSD card (4GB included) for an HD record of your adventure. Additionally, Wi-Fi enables you to stream a live first-person view (FPV) feed from the camera directly to a mobile device, such as a smartphone or tablet. Both Android and iOS devices are supported.

Fully-Assembled Airframe 818A Wi-Fi edition comes ready-to-fly, meaning that the airframe is fully assembled and all of the essential components are included (four AA batteries will be required for the controller).

Headless Mode "Headless Mode" is an intelligent-orientation mode that allows you to fly the quadcopter as if it were properly oriented, regardless of which direction the "nose" or front of the quad is pointed.

  • Does this drone have a return home button?

    No. However, it is equipped with an Auto Land feature in the case of an emergency. This one button feature will self land the drone in the event that you lose control or become disorientated.
  • Do I need to use my phone to record video?

    Yes, you will need to first insert a microSD card into the drone. Using your smart phone, you will need to press the record button to start recording. You MUST also stop recording prior to disconnecting the battery.
  • I noticed there are what look like 2 batteries that are linked together. Does the drone automatically switch to the second battery once the first battery drains?

    It is only one battery. What you are referring to are the cells of the battery. Each cell is wired together in a series circuit. This means they work together and drain equally at the same rate. They are NOT to be separated.
  • What is the max control distance?

    The max control range for this drone is 150m unobstructed. When you are reaching the max distance the controller will single an audible alarm to notify you are reaching the max range. NEVER exceed the max control range.
  • Does this model have altitude hold?

    This drone is equipped with Altitude Mode which means using the onboard barometer, the drone will read changes in the atmospheric pressure and attempt to keep the drone hovering in place.
  • If your not connected to the WiFi, will you still be able to see in first person video?


    No, you will need a WiFi enabled device to see the video stream. You do not need an existing WiFi network. The Delta Recon creates it’s own network that you can connect regardless of location.
  • Is there a way to track where the drone landed?

    No. Unfortunately, this drone is not equipped with GPS or another tracking system. For this reason, we recommend you keep a line of sight of your drone at all times.
  • Does this drone need a rest period?

    The type of motor used in this model is called a “brushed motor” they have no way of cooling themselves, other then time. It is recommended with all brushed motors you perform a rest/cool down period.
  • After a crash what do I need to do?

    First thing that should be done after a crash is a visual inspection of the drone. Look for any damage and perform any repairs. If nothing seems to be damaged, you should ALWAYS perform and recalibrate to ensure a safe flight.
  • How good is the camera?

    The onboard camera is a 720P 30/fps. It is comparable to a hand held smart phone. That said, the intention of this drone is not for profession video production.
  • I want to buy 2 is there a problem fling them at the same time?

    No, the controllers will auto-bind to each drone separately on different channels not to interfere with each drones individual controls. However, we recommend first connecting to one then the other so you have control over which drone is bound to what controller.
  • Does is it have lights to fly at night?

    Yes, there are LED lights under each motor, that allow you visual orientation for night-time flight. However, first time flyers are not recommended to fly at night.
  • One of the motors stopped working and was hot. Suggestions?

    Check that any debris such as dirt or hair is obstructing the motor from spinning. If that does not seem to be the problem, you may need to replace the motor. The life span of the motors will very depending on the aggressiveness of flight and frequency of use.
